How has Southern Europe contributed to the<br> arts? Provide specific example
Yakvenalex [24]

Some of the southern European countries have contributed to the development of world art, the best example of them is Italy.

<h3>How did Italy contribute to art?</h3>

Italy is a sovereign country in southern Europe that has been characterized by its great contributions to the world of art throughout history. There arose one of the most important human civilizations, the Roman Empire.

Since Roman times, art, especially sculpture in marble and other materials, was the main activity of artists. Once the Middle Ages began, artists focused on painting. Later, during modernity, painting was also used as a means to express the feelings and ideologies of society.

Some of the most outstanding works are:

  • The Sistine Chapel - Michelangelo Buonarotti
  • The last supper - Leonardo da vinci
  • The Gioconda - Leonardo Da Vinci
  • Birth of Venus - Sandro Botticelli

Another prominent country in the field of art is Spain, where talented artists have emerged such as:

  • Pablo Picasso
  • Johan Miro
  • Salvador Dali
  • Francisco de Goya

What is the difference between science and pseudoscience
Jlenok [28]

Answer:

Science is certain about ending up with the actual explanation while pseudoscience does not ensure that.

Science is involved with a set of principles to work, while pseudoscience is not operated in a unique method.

Science is based on tangible or perceptible evidence, but pseudoscience could be based on some superficial or outlandish concepts.
